Porcon Beach – Cancale loop from Le Vivier-sur-Mer

02:01

31.3km

160m

Mountain biking

Moderate mountain bike ride. Good fitness required. Suitable for all skill levels. The starting point of the route is accessible with public transport.

Moulin de Moidrey

Highlight • Monument

The bay of Mont-St-Michel is dotted with historic windmills, most of them wingless, some converted into dwelling houses. This dates from 1806 and resumed service in 2003 after more than …

Cancale

Highlight • Settlement

Cancale, also known as the pearl of the Emerald Coast, has long been renowned for its oysters and shellfish, which can be enjoyed while admiring Mont Saint-Michel, in the middle of the bay.
